Every Yom Tov has it’s signature song.

Pesach has Dayeinu

Chanuka has Maoz Tzur

and Purim has Shoshannas Yaakov!

Just in time for Purim we are treated to a new single by Hillel Kapnick and fresh recording artist Baruch Naftel. While working on this track, Hillel decided that the production would benefit greatly from a collaboration with a second vocalist. While considering many singers for this project the obvious choice was co-composer and talented vocalist Baruch Naftel. Although you may have seen Baruch and Hillel performing together at many simchas, this is the first single they are releasing as a team. While you may think that one collaboration would be enough, well known Jewish Musician Aryeh Kunstler also plays a role performing the backing vocals throughout the track.
